Bagikan melalui


Track.ViewportSize Properti

Definisi

Mendapatkan atau mengatur ukuran bagian konten yang dapat digulirkan yang terlihat.

public:
 property double ViewportSize { double get(); void set(double value); };
public double ViewportSize { get; set; }
member this.ViewportSize : double with get, set
Public Property ViewportSize As Double

Nilai Properti

Ukuran area yang terlihat dari konten yang dapat digulir. Defaultnya adalah NaN, yang berarti bahwa ukuran konten tidak ditentukan.

Keterangan

Nilai ViewportSize properti digunakan untuk menghitung ukuran Thumb kontrol saat ScrollBarViewportSize bukan Double.NaN. Untuk informasi selengkapnya, lihat keterangan untuk Thumb properti .

Untuk secara eksplisit menentukan ukuran Thumb, buat objek yang berasal dari Track kelas dan berikan penimpaan untuk MeasureOverride dan ArrangeOverride.

Jika Anda menerapkan Track sebagai bagian ScrollBar dari kontrol dan Anda tidak secara eksplisit mengatur Track.ViewportSize properti , Track.ViewportSize properti mengikat ke ScrollBar.ViewportSize properti .

Nilai ViewportSize properti Track kontrol yang diimplementasikan dalam Slider kontrol selalu Double.NaN, karena Thumb kontrol tidak mengubah ukuran.

Informasi Properti Dependensi

Bidang pengidentifikasi ViewportSizeProperty
Properti metadata diatur ke true AffectsArrange

Berlaku untuk

Lihat juga